A rotary union for a motor vehicle wheel with tire pressure regulation comprises a wheel carrier and a wheel hub rotatably mounted on the wheel carrier. In an intermediate space between the wheel carrier and the wheel hub, a compressed air annular chamber (21) and at least one lubricant annular chamber (22) are formed, which are sealed off from one another. The compressed air annular chamber (21) communicates with a compressed air duct of the wheel carrier and with a compressed air duct of the wheel hub, wherein the compressed air duct of the wheel hub communicates with a controllable valve in order to selectively inflate or deflate a tire of the motor vehicle wheel with compressed air. The lubricant annular chamber (22) in turn communicates with a lubricant duct of the wheel carrier and with a lubricant duct of the wheel hub, wherein the lubricant duct of the wheel hub leads to a control port of the valve in order to selectively control the valve to allow passage of compressed air.
